Nginx-ru mailing list archive (nginx-ru@sysoev.ru)
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
Re: РИТ: Высокие нагру зки vs Highload++
On Tue, Sep 16, 2008 at 08:57:52PM +0400, Монашёв Михаил wrote:
> Мелкие картинки напрочь убивают всю производительность SATA дисков.
>
> >> А какие диски и как они собраны?
>
> > 4 диска - SATA, Hitachi 1T.
> > gmirror, round-robin.
>
> А почему round-robin? Ведь в этом случае один большой файл будут
> отдавать все 4 диска. А это много сиков. При load сиков теоретически
> может быть меньше, ибо менять диск нужно не всегда.
Потому что load теоретически выглядит правильно, а практически какой-нибудь
один диск всё время ничего не делает. Что касается round-robin'а, то в
нашем случае запросы на кусок файла уходят на один диск, не трогая три
остальных. И эти остальные доступны для трёх друрих кусков.
> > Но во всём этом сетапе ключевым является то, что у нас огромные файлы,
> > а не куча мелких (типа картинок).
>
> >> > Не знаю, но в рамках одной машины мы упёрлись в то, что bge на FreeBSD
> >> > не может передать больше 700Mbit/s, а у дисков ещё есть некоторый запас
> >> > до 1Gbit/s. На других картах пока не тестировали.
--
Игорь Сысоев
http://sysoev.ru
|